**Restaurant Review: A Mixed Bag Experience**
Nestled in Balloch, this restaurant presents a wide-ranging menu that includes Scottish cuisine alongside Turkish and Italian dishes. While some patrons rave about the exceptional steaks and outstanding service, others express disappointment with food quality, poor cleanliness, and uninviting surroundings. Positive experiences highlighted the accommodating staff and hearty meals, such as the steak pie and fish and chips. However, diners have also noted issues like cold, overcooked dishes and lackluster desserts. For those seeking a reliable meal, the restaurant shows potential, but it may fall short of expectations for a polished dining experience.

I don't say this lightly: it's the best steak pie I've ever had. Our group of eight visited after touring the Balloch side of Loch Lomond, and the service was outstanding. The staff attended to every request and went above and beyond. They even kept the kids happy with some complimentary garlic bread while our food was being prepared. I would return here in a heartbeat.
My husband and I ordered sirloin steaks, and when the food arrived, we were disappointed with the presentation. The steaks were cold, overcooked, and extremely dry, making them inedible. We definitely won't be returning.
Uncommon Sunday opening in Balloch. The limited Sunday menu lacks Turkish dishes and pizzas. However, the staff is friendly, and the food is decent, although it feels a bit pricey for us.
